This book presents a historical and synchronic overview of the pedagogical science, focusing on its theoretical and research approaches.

Specifically, it deals with key terms and concepts as well as the evolution of pedagogical science through texts and sources from its history, particularly emphasizing the need for a critical pedagogy.

It also refers to milestones in pedagogical thought and practice, the relationship of pedagogical science with other sciences (through collaboration with researchers in the field), as well as the methods and methodological approaches used.

Particular emphasis is placed on pedagogical innovations and the contemporary, significant issues and themes of pedagogical science today (e.g., in the education and training of teachers, the role of the modern educator, multiculturalism, the attitude towards the "other," the role of humanistic/person-centered education, citizen education, etc.).

Furthermore, this study refers to alternative forms of teaching and education by presenting cases and examples and concludes with a discussion around crisis and education, featuring texts from international scholars.

The book concludes with a proposal-model for the pedagogy of the 21st century, based on a modern approach to pedagogical theories and practices aimed at the education of the individual and a human-centered view of knowledge and pedagogical science.
